Handover note — Crumbwheel order cutoffs.

Welcome aboard. The bakery cutoff rule in Crumbwheel closes same-day orders at 14:00 local to each storefront, not UTC — this has bitten us twice. Holiday overrides live in the calendar service and take precedence silently, so always check there first when a cutoff looks wrong. To unlock the calendar service's admin console after a restart, enter the recovery passphrase below.

vault phrase of bagap-bahaf = silion-pelox-sorox-casdor-quenwyn-fraax-eliox-praael-kelion-quenvan-kasox-rusael-norius-belvan

Step 3: Signing the FeedTrue Validator Release

Before publishing, future maintainers must sign the validator artifact so downstream Castwell nodes accept it. Build with the `--reproducible` flag, confirm the checksum matches the CI record, and only then proceed to signing. Never reuse keys from previous major versions, as the trust store drops them on upgrade. Sign using the current release key:

rollout seal: bky4_x7Gc

Subject: Blue-green cutover tonight — LedgerMill billing worker

Team,

We're flipping the LedgerMill billing worker to the green pool at 02:00. Blue stays warm for 45 minutes as rollback. On-call: watch the invoice-retry queue during the drain window; anything above 200 pending means abort and flip back. No schema changes ride along, so rollback is a pure traffic switch. Dashboards are already pointed at green. If you need to correlate logs during cutover, use the trace token below.

pipeline stamp: htk31_f769b577b3028a4e9958e5bb8d1259a

## Deployment: Locker Access Flow

TumbleBay issues one-time codes when a laundry cycle completes. The locker gateway polls the cycle service every 30 seconds; codes expire after two hours. If residents report dead keypads, restart the gateway pod before escalating. Support deployments of the gateway must match the settings shown below.

deployment values, yadup-kadug:
[sorys]
port = 5672
team = noveth
host = sorys.orvexcorp.example
region = south-4
access_code = ac_deddc1
timeout_ms = 1500